Draught-proofing can be undertaken utilizing various strategies and materials customized to the specifics of the sash window. Below are the most typical techniques:
1. Weatherstripping
Weatherstripping involves using a strip of product around the window's frame to produce a seal. This method is versatile and can accommodate differing gap sizes.
Kinds of Weatherstripping:Felt: Inexpensive and easy to apply however not very durable.Vinyl: Offers much better insulation and is more weather-resistant.Foam Tape: A simple, self-adhesive option that offers excellent insulation.2. Draught Excluders
Draught excluders are materials placed at the base of the window sill to prevent cold air from getting in. These can be permanent or removable, depending upon personal choice.
Options Include:PVC Draught Excluders: Affordable and efficient for long-term use.Fabric Draught Excluders: These can include a decorative aspect while serving their practical purpose.3. Secondary Glazing
Secondary glazing includes installing a second layer of glazing to develop an insulating barrier. This not just decreases draughts but also improves soundproofing and thermal performance.
Benefits of Secondary Glazing:Lower setup expenses compared to finish window replacement.Increased insulation without modifying the appearance of the initial sash window.4. Insulating Paint
While not a direct form of draught proofing, insulating paint can be used to the window frame to lower heat transfer. This method is less common however beneficial for boosting overall window efficiency.
5. Window Films
Window movies can improve insulation and decrease glare. These movies are easy to use and can offer extra UV protection.
Step-by-Step Guide to Draught Proofing Sash Windows
Below is a simplified step-by-step guide for homeowners thinking about draught proofing their sash windows:
Step 1: Assess the GapsDetermine areas where air is leaking. This can be done by running your hand around the window frame or utilizing a candle light to spot drafts.Action 2: Clean the AreaMake sure that the areas around the window frames are tidy and free from debris to ensure proper adhesion of materials.Action 3: Choose Your MethodSelect the appropriate draught-proofing technique or mix of techniques based upon the size of gaps and budget.Step 4: Install WeatherstrippingUse the picked weatherstripping around the window frames, following the producer's guidelines for best results.Step 5: Position Draught ExcludersPlace draught excluders at the base of the window sill if necessary, making sure a tight fit.Step 6: Regular MaintenanceRegularly examine the window seals and Draught excluders to guarantee they stay effective. Replace them if wear and tear appear.FAQs about Sash Window Draught Proofing
